Livingston Resident Since 1979 Andre J. LeGuen (Andy) 71, died peacefully at Saint Barnabas Medical Center on November 2, 2017, surrounded by his loving family. Born in Newark, Andy grew up in Irvington, enjoying many fun summers at Cook’s Pond. Although Andy began his career as a computer programmer, he was also passionate about art and all phases of design. Ultimately, he focused on design and established Andre Design Inc. in Millburn, New Jersey. As president and general manager, he designed and oversaw the creation of custom pieces of jewelry for private clients and events. Seeking new challenges in design, Andy sold his business and became an AutoCAD, web and graphic designer. In 1997, Andy joined Training Inc. at Essex County College as an instructor in desktop publishing, layout and design, math, and tutor in AutoCad. Andy was able share his love of design and contribute to the success of many students. His time working with Training Inc. and all of the students was the most meaningful of his career. A talented scenic painter, Andy was an avid fan of the Giants and NASCAR who enjoyed spending time with family and friends at Ocean City, Maryland and at home in Livingston. Andy is survived by his wife of 47 years, Ann; his sister, JoAnn Luciano and her husband, James, of Mount Tabor; his brother-in-law, William Best of Indiana; his nieces, Susan McGowan and Diana Vilcek; his nephews, James and Damon Luciano, and David Best. Private arrangements were made through Quinn Hopping Funeral Home. The family is planning a celebration of Andy’s life to be scheduled for some time in the near future. In honor of Andy’s passion and commitment to life-long learning, the family has established a scholarship in his name, Andre J. LeGuen, at Essex County College.
